Transaction 84135b13b09d58cbeae3905ed0a1c9114db944bb6f08cdf4a491b7ab84d4afd9
1 Input
1 Output
-
84135b13b09d58cbeae3905ed0a1c9114db944bb6f08cdf4a491b7ab84d4afd9:0
- value
- 1988662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e90b2e4b0d8ba0a219dcb9d2bc43ae4a9a1820a2 OP_EQUAL
- address
- 3NwEm6eKee1QcexrftuiSBqfnxwCg6ojxG